Family tree Brouwer » engelina van den brink (1837-1874)

Personal data engelina van den brink 

  • She was born in the year 1837 in laren.
  • She died on June 6, 1874 in bussum, she was 37 years old.

Household of engelina van den brink

She is married to isaak hendrikus dionijsius kaarsgaren.

They got married on June 18, 1861 at laren, she was 24 years old.
